MAIN FEATURES:
 
LUGGAGE STORAGE- 
By making the bike electric and placing the battery under the seat i was left with a lot of space in the fuel tank. Appealing to The North Faces modern push for stylish products i wanted to make sure the bike was visible. This in contrast to most adventure bikes where everything hides the beautiful design beneath.
MUD GUARD/SKI-
Rotation about the center this piece allows you ASCEND to new heights before skiing down the slopes for a different sensation.
 
COMPASS CHARGING POINT- 
As a compass always 'Faces North' i wanted a simple way to incorporate a charging port that feels familiar and practical to normal bikers. This compass lights up and guides the way north.
 
REAR TRACK-
For best traction over loose terrain and snow, the track helps convert the power from the HUB motor to the ground.
CENTER-HUB STEERING (BY WIRE)- 
By roving forks it feed up more space. The mechanism i have chosen have never been combined and isn't favored, however with 10 years of research i believe this mechanisms could be developed to be effective.

THE NORTH FACE: ASCENDER

6 WEEK PROJECT
1ST YEAR AT COVENTRY UNIVERSITY
AUTOMOTIVE AND TRANSPORT DESIGN 

Digital work in Photoshop
Modeled Using Autodesk Alias - Sub D
Aid of Blender and BLENDERKIT for small technical parts (Springs, Hydraulic Arms, Handles, Battery, Brakes)
Rendered in VRED
